Nick Denton's Gawker empire of gossip Web sites loves to expose everyone else's secrets -- but he's tight-lipped about the confidential settlement made with art collector/gallery owner Keya Morgan. Two years ago, Morgan -- who is making a documentary, "Marilyn Monroe: Murder on Fifth Helena Drive" -- brokered the $1.5 million sale of the Monroe sex tape. Gawker's La-based sister site, Defamer, claimed no such tape existed and depicted Morgan as a hoaxer, so he sued for $50 million. The case was settled this week. The original Defamer posts were deleted, but neither party is allowed to discuss the terms.
